Get PriceThere are three types of electroless nickel low phos mid phos and high phos Low phos has a thickness of 0011 It is a hard deposit approaching hard chrome with no heat treatment necessary for hardness It is comparable to boron electroless nickel This deposit is used mainly for its hardness and wear properties
Get PriceLow Phosphorus usually has between 1 4% phosphorus in the chemical deposit while Medium Phosphorus has between 5 9% phosphorus Anything greater than 9% phosphorus is referred to as High Phosphorus The variance of this phosphorus content in the Electroless Nickel plating deposit has significant impact on the mechanical properties of the

Get PriceThe average thickness of electroless plating can be as thin as 0005 and up to as thick as 010 This process provides an excellent resistance to corrosion wear and hardness to the component These components tend to be resistant to a variety of chemicals which makes it fit for several applications and industry needs
Get PriceElectroless nickel is generally applied to a thickness range of 12 to 25 microns to and typically does not require further surface finishing machining or grinding after plating The coating creates a thick barrier that fills any minor imperfections in the substrate

Get PriceHigh Phosphorus Electroless Nickel is an alloy of 10 12% Phosphorus in nickel and is specified wherever a uniform hard and highly corrosion resistant coating is required Its high hardness and lack of porosity make it an ideal barrier coating for components exposed to aggressive usage or hostile environments

Get PriceElectroless nickel plating is an autocatalytic process that deposits a nickel phosphorus or nickel boron alloy onto a solid surface via chemical reaction without electricity Its primary purpose is to enhance a product s corrosion and wear properties it also improves solderability and lubricity Electroless nickel is distinctive in that it
Get PriceElectroless nickel plating can be deposited at a rate of 5 microns per hour up to 25 microns per hour The coating thickness is essentially without limit because the process is continuous however as the thickness increases it becomes more susceptible to imperfections

Get PriceAdvantages of Electroless Nickel Plating Excellent corrosion resistance Excellent wear and abrasion resistance Good ductility lubricity and electrical properties High hardness especially when heat treated Good solderability Even and uniform thickness even down deep bores and recesses and at corners and edges
